11. Oscillator Characteristics
12
AT89S51
Figure 10-1. Interrupt Sources
XTAL1 and XTAL2 are the input and output, respectively, of an inverting amplifier that can be
configured for use as an on-chip oscillator, as shown in
ceramic resonator may be used. To drive the device from an external clock source, XTAL2
should be left unconnected while XTAL1 is driven, as shown in
requirements on the duty cycle of the external clock signal, since the input to the internal clock-
ing circuitry is through a divide-by-two flip-flop, but minimum and maximum voltage high and low
time specifications must be observed.
Figure 11-1. Oscillator Connections
Note:
C1, C2
= 30 pF ± 10 pF for Crystals
= 40 pF ± 10 pF for Ceramic Resonators
